Valproate
A medication commonly used to treat seizure disorders, bipolar disorder, and to prevent migraine headaches.
Gabapentin
is a medication commonly used to treat nerve pain, epilepsy, and sometimes restless legs syndrome or postherpetic neuralgia.
Hippocampus
A region of the brain involved in forming, organizing, and storing memories, crucial for learning and spatial navigation.
Temporal Lobe
A region of the brain located beneath the temples, crucial for processing sensory input and involved in memory, emotion, and language.
